George Percivall GeoRoundtable <https://www.linkedin.com/company/geo-roundtable/> > On Oct 14, 2022, at 9:37 AM, Bertil Chapuis <bchap...@gmail.com> wrote: > > Hello Geospatial, > > I’m really excited to announce that Baremaps has been accepted in the > Incubator. > > As stated in the proposal [1], Baremaps is a toolkit and a set of > infrastructure components for creating, publishing, and operating online > maps. In addition to learning the Apache Way our goals are: > - to grow a community and attract new contributors; > - to release a customizable attribution-free map schema and style; > - to publish a tiled world map in different formats (mvt, png, 3D Tiles Next, > etc.); > - to release additional services and components (IP to location, location > search, etc.). > > Do not hesitate to check the status of our ongoing effort to create vector > tiles based on OpenStreetMap data [2]. > > Our main challenge will be to form and grow a community around the project. > Do not hesitate to share your thoughts here or in our dev mailing list [3]. > We are eager to learn more about your use cases and to join the Geospatial > community at Apache. > > Best regards, > > Bertil Chapuis > > [1] https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/INCUBATOR/Baremaps+Proposal > [2] https://demo.baremaps.com/ > [3] https://lists.apache.org/list.html?dev@baremaps.apache.org
